U2 History on this Day
- On a chart dated May 16, “With or Without You” peaks in the Billboard Hot 100 chart in the USA at #1, giving U2 their first #1 in the USA. (1987)
- On a chart dated May 16, “One” peaks in the Billboard Hot 100 chart in the USA at #10. (1992)
